Optimi Health Corp. (FRA:8BN)
Germany flag Germany · Delayed Price · Currency is EUR
0.1900
-0.0040 (-2.06%)
Jan 27, 2026, 4:00 PM EST

Optimi Health Ratios and Metrics

Millions EUR. Fiscal year is Oct - Sep.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Jan '26 Sep '25 Sep '24 Sep '23 Sep '22 Sep '21
182315111931
Market Cap Growth
23.69%50.98%34.08%-39.66%-38.92%-
Enterprise Value
222417111619
Last Close Price
0.190.210.150.110.250.41
PS Ratio
69.9787.2858.2888.92310.87-
PB Ratio
4.545.662.371.221.572.12
P/TBV Ratio
4.545.662.371.221.572.12
EV/Sales Ratio
81.6093.7764.5686.10265.93-
Debt / Equity Ratio
0.990.990.290.130.010.01
Asset Turnover
0.030.030.030.010.00-
Inventory Turnover
0.820.820.140.641.11-
Quick Ratio
0.150.150.070.942.735.64
Current Ratio
0.220.220.381.513.336.39
Return on Equity (ROE)
-45.98%-45.98%-52.98%-35.54%-39.64%-45.68%
Return on Assets (ROA)
-18.58%-18.58%-21.54%-19.18%-21.50%-22.57%
Return on Capital Employed (ROCE)
-65.80%-65.80%-47.20%-34.30%-43.10%-25.20%
Earnings Yield
-12.44%-9.98%-26.57%-32.26%-29.29%-13.46%
FCF Yield
-9.11%-7.30%-19.52%-27.36%-46.75%-24.51%
Buyback Yield / Dilution
-7.20%-7.20%-2.94%-11.60%-50.11%-280.36%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.